跳转到内容

Excel开发项目优化技巧,如何提升工作效率?

零门槛、免安装!海量模板方案,点击即可,在线试用!

免费试用

Excel开发项目通常涉及以下几个核心方面:1、数据处理与自动化;2、可视化报表与数据分析;3、系统集成与流程优化;4、低代码/零代码平台辅助开发。 其中,随着企业数字化转型需求的提升,越来越多企业通过零代码平台(如简道云)实现Excel开发项目的快速部署和维护。例如,简道云零代码开发平台(官网地址:https://www.jiandaoyun.com/register?utm_src=nbwzseonlzc; )为用户提供可视化拖拽式建模与丰富的模板库,大幅降低了开发门槛,并支持将传统Excel表格功能在线升级为协同办公系统,有效解决了数据分散、安全性弱等问题。本文将详细解析Excel开发项目的主要内容、关键技术和最佳实践,并结合简道云等平台的实际应用场景,为企业信息化建设提供全方位参考。

《excel开发项目》

一、EXCEL开发项目概述及应用场景

Excel作为全球最流行的数据处理工具之一,在企业日常管理中扮演着不可替代的角色。以下为常见的Excel开发项目类型及其业务应用场景:

项目类别应用场景主要功能
数据录入与管理客户档案、库存管理批量录入、校验规则
报表自动生成销售日报、财务分析数据汇总、图表展示
数据分析与建模市场调查结果分析公式建模、数据透视
流程审批请假审批单、人事流程审批流转、多级权限
系统集成与ERP/CRM对接数据同步/API调用

场景说明

  1. 客户信息管理:用Excel制作客户信息登记与跟踪表,通过VBA或插件实现自动提醒。
  2. 销售业绩统计:利用数据透视表和动态图表,实现销售团队业绩一键查看。
  3. 费用报销流程:通过公式+条件格式+VBA,实现报销单自动校验和审批记录归档。
  4. 多部门协作:使用SharePoint或简道云等平台,将传统Excel升级为多人在线协同编辑系统。

二、EXCEL自动化开发核心技术手段对比

在实际项目中,常用的Excel自动化技术路线包括以下几种:

技术方案开发难度适用范围优势局限性
VBA脚本较高单机办公、小型团队功能强大,自定义灵活学习曲线陡峭,兼容性有限
Excel插件中等特定业务扩展易于安装,即插即用功能受限于插件本身
Power Query中等数据清洗与整合自动化导入转化数据对复杂业务逻辑支持有限
Power BI结合使用可视化报表、大数据分析动态仪表盘,高级分析成本较高,对IT环境要求较高
零代码/低代码平台(如简道云)极低各类业务流程系统无需编程,模板丰富,支持移动端高阶自定义能力略逊于专业程序员

详细展开——零代码/低代码平台(以简道云为例)

零代码平台如【简道云】(官网:https://www.jiandaoyun.com/register?utm_src=nbwzseonlzc; )通过可视化拖拽方式,让非IT人员也能搭建类似于“在线版Excel”的业务应用。其优势包括:

  • 内置1000+行业通用模板,一键套用;
  • 表单设计灵活,可设置字段校验及关联下拉;
  • 支持多端同步访问,实现远程办公;
  • 强大的权限控制体系保障数据安全;
  • 内嵌流程引擎,可配置多级审批流。

举例:某制造企业原先通过Excel收集采购申请,经常因版本混乱导致统计出错。引入简道云后,将采购申请单迁移至线上,每条申请实时归档,相关负责人可通过手机APP随时审批,大大缩短了采购周期并提升了准确率。

三、EXCEL向企业级管理系统进阶的必经路径

传统以Excel为基础的信息管理虽便捷,但存在如下痛点:

  1. 多人编辑易冲突
  2. 权限难以细分
  3. 数据安全性差
  4. 审批流不规范
  5. 难以对接其它系统

因此,越来越多企业选择“升级”——即借助零/低代码平台将静态文档变为动态在线SaaS工具。具体路径如下:

步骤一:梳理现有业务流程及关键字段 步骤二:挑选适合的平台(如简道云)进行原型搭建 步骤三:按需选择官方模板或自定义设计界面 步骤四:配置权限及审批流节点 步骤五:测试上线并培训用户

下列表格对比了两种做法优劣:

指标项传统Excel方案零/低代码平台方案
协作效率较低实时多人协作,高效率
权限控制粗放精细到字段级
审批流设计手动可视化配置,多条件分支
集成能力支持API/第三方集成
安全保障  一般  银行级加密,多重备份

案例说明 某地产公司财务部门从传统财务日报迁移到零代码系统后,不仅实现了跨区域团队实时共享,还可直接生成图形报表并邮件推送,大幅缩减人工统计时间。

四、EXCEL开发项目实践要点及典型误区规避

在推动基于Excel或其升级形态的信息系统建设时,应重点关注以下事项:

项目实施要点:

  • 明确需求边界,防止“无限扩展”
  • 梳理核心业务流程,不盲目堆叠功能
  • 优先选择标准模板,提高上线速度
  • 注重用户培训和持续支持
  • 定期回顾优化迭代

常见误区:

  1. 将所有复杂逻辑都放在公式/VBA内——维护困难,一旦作者离职易出现断层。
  2. 忽略权限细分——导致敏感信息泄露风险增加。
  3. 忽略备份和日志审计——无法追溯异常操作源头。
  4. 平台选型只看价格——忽略长远扩展性和服务能力。

建议采用如下最佳实践清单进行管控:

- 制定规范的数据命名规则
- 合理拆分主子表结构,避免“大杂烩”式sheet堆积
- 建立版本控制机制(如平台内置快照)
- 配置操作日志审计功能

五、“无缝迁移”:如何从EXCEL平滑过渡到零/低代码平台?

顺利实现无缝迁移,一般应按照如下步骤推进:

  1. 对现有所有重要工作簿进行梳理分类;
  2. 确定哪些内容可以直接迁移为标准模板;
  3. 对涉及复杂计算或外部接口部分提前评估是否需要二次开发;
  4. 利用如简道云的平台导入功能,一键上传历史数据;
  5. 配置好新系统中的字段映射关系及初始权限设定;
  6. 分阶段切换,保证新老系统平滑衔接不影响正常运转。

下列表格展示了不同类型工作的迁移难度评估建议:

| 工作簿类型  迁移难度  推荐操作方式   |- |- |- - 简单明细类台账 低 一键导入作为原始资料库 含大量公式计算模型 中 拆解逻辑后重构至新平台 需集成外部API接口 高 分步迭代逐步替换 涉及跨部门多角色协作的复合台账 中高 优先试点小范围运行再全面推广

举例说明 某互联网公司的人力资源团队将各类员工花名册、自助请假记录直接导入至简道云,通过拖拽式字段配置,只用了两天就完成全部历史资料上“云”,并开放自助查询接口给各部门主管,有效提升响应速度。

六、“智能时代”的EXCEL项目新趋势—AI、大模型赋能办公自动化

近年来AI大模型发展迅猛,也正影响着基于Excel的数据处理模式。典型趋势包括:

  1. 智能推荐公式&函数填充,如Copilot for Excel等辅助工具上线,提高建模效率。
  2. 自动识别数据模式,根据历史填报智能补全缺漏项。
  3. 与自然语言交互生成报表,无需手写公式即可完成复杂汇总。
  4. 与ERP/MES/CRM等大型系统深度打通,实现跨界融合。

未来建议在构建新一代信息管理体系时,将AI能力纳入评价维度。例如优先选择兼容AI助手的平台,以便随时获得智能运维支持。

总结与行动建议

本文围绕“excel开发项目”主题,从实际应用场景出发,对比了主流技术路线,并重点介绍了如何借助像【简道云】这样的零代码开发平台(官方网址:https://www.jiandaoyun.com/register?utm_src=nbwzseonlzc; )实现快速、高效、安全的信息化升级。在实际推进过程中,应充分利用标准模板、高效协作机制和完善的权限体系,同时关注用户体验与持续优化,不断推动组织数字能力成长。未来,可结合AI赋能进一步释放生产力,让每个员工都成为“轻量级IT专家”。


100+企业管理系统模板免费使用>>>无需下载,在线安装: https://s.fanruan.com/l0cac

精品问答:


Excel开发项目如何有效规划与管理?

作为一个刚接触Excel开发项目的新人,我经常感到项目规划混乱,难以把控进度和资源。如何才能系统性地规划和管理Excel开发项目,保证按时交付?

有效规划与管理Excel开发项目,关键在于明确需求、制定详细的时间表和资源分配方案。建议采用甘特图进行进度跟踪,利用Excel内置的任务分配模板提高团队协作效率。例如,通过设置阶段性目标和里程碑,可以将整个开发周期细分为需求分析、模块设计、编码实现和测试部署四个阶段。此外,结合敏捷开发方法,每周迭代更新,有助于及时发现并解决问题。据统计,采用结构化项目管理方法的Excel开发团队,其项目准时交付率提升了30%以上。

在Excel开发项目中如何优化VBA代码性能?

我在做Excel VBA自动化时发现运行速度很慢,有时候甚至卡顿。我想知道有哪些技巧可以用来优化VBA代码性能,使得我的Excel开发项目更加高效?

优化VBA代码性能主要从减少计算量、避免重复操作和合理使用数据结构入手。具体方法包括:

  1. 禁用屏幕刷新(Application.ScreenUpdating = False)
  2. 关闭自动计算(Application.Calculation = xlCalculationManual)
  3. 使用数组一次性读写大量数据,避免循环逐单元格操作
  4. 避免使用Select或Activate方法,提高代码简洁度 例如,在处理百万行数据时,将数据先加载至数组进行处理,再写回工作表,可提升执行速度10倍以上。实践中,通过这些优化措施,可以使复杂的Excel VBA宏运行时间从数分钟缩短到几十秒。

如何确保Excel开发项目的数据安全与备份?

我担心在进行大型Excel开发项目时,重要数据可能丢失或被误操作破坏。我想了解有哪些有效的数据安全措施和备份策略可以应用于Excel开发项目中?

确保数据安全与备份是Excel开发项目的重要环节。推荐采用以下措施:

  • 定期自动备份文件至云端(如OneDrive、Google Drive),实现异地存储
  • 设置工作簿密码保护关键数据区域,防止非授权修改
  • 利用版本控制工具(如Git配合xlwings插件)跟踪代码变更历史
  • 实施严格权限管理,仅允许特定用户访问敏感内容 据相关调查显示,有效的数据安全策略可降低70%的数据丢失风险,并提升恢复效率50%。结合这些方法,可以最大限度保障您的Excel开发成果安全可靠。

怎样利用多线程技术提升大型Excel开发项目的处理能力?

我听说多线程技术可以加速程序运行,但不知道在传统的单线程环境下的Excel中是否适用。在我的大型Excel开发项目中,该如何利用多线程技术来提升处理能力呢?

虽然原生VBA不支持多线程,但可以借助外部工具或语言实现多线程处理,例如通过调用Python脚本(利用pandas库)或C#编写COM组件,实现并行计算。此外,新版Office支持Office JavaScript API,可以结合异步编程提高响应速度。例如,将复杂计算任务拆分为多个子任务并行执行,再汇总结果,可显著缩短整体运行时间。据测试,多线程辅助处理能将大型数据集运算时间缩短40%-60%。因此,在大型Excel开发项目中合理引入多线程技术,是提升性能的重要途径。

文章版权归" "www.jiandaoyun.com所有。
转载请注明出处:https://www.jiandaoyun.com/nblog/78161/
温馨提示:文章由AI大模型生成,如有侵权,联系 mumuerchuan@gmail.com 删除。